“Duluth for Mandela: A Northland Celebration” Film Screening

Join us for the Twin Cities premiere screening of Duluth for Mandela: A Northland Celebration at the Minnesota History Center. Duluth for Mandela: A Northland Celebration is an inspiring film for all ages highlighting how the Duluth community honored the centenary of South African freedom fighter and Nobel laureate, Nelson Mandela. Stirring music, art, dance, and more portray the values of reconciliation, inclusion and transformative joy embodied in Mandela’s life.

Following the film, producer/director Gerri Williams will be joined by Carl Crawford, Equity and Inclusion Specialist for St. Louis County, for a panel discussion. Mr. Crawford most recently served as the Human Rights Officer for the City of Duluth.
